What does a food influencer do?

A food influencer creates and shares content related to food, such as recipes, restaurant reviews, and food photography, often on social media platforms. They build an online following by engaging audiences with appealing visuals and informative posts, sometimes collaborating with brands for sponsored content.

What is the difference between Food Influencer vs Food Blogger?

AspectFood InfluencerFood Blogger
CredentialsTypically no formal credentials requiredOften no formal credentials, but some may have culinary or writing backgrounds
Work EnvironmentPrimarily social media platforms, on-the-go content creationPersonal websites, blogs, and social media
Industry UsagePopular in digital marketing, brand collaborationsFocus on detailed recipes, reviews, and storytelling
Search & Comparison IntentHigh overlap in social media marketing and food promotionMore focused on in-depth content and SEO

Food Influencers primarily create short-form content on social media to promote food brands and trends, often without formal credentials. Food Bloggers tend to produce detailed articles, recipes, and reviews on personal websites or blogs. While both roles involve food content creation, Food Influencers focus on engaging audiences quickly via social media, whereas Food Bloggers emphasize in-depth storytelling and SEO-driven content.

What is a food influencer?

A food influencer is someone who creates and shares content about food, cooking, dining experiences, recipes, and related topics on social media platforms or blogs. They often collaborate with brands, restaurants, and other companies to promote food products or dining establishments. Food influencers use their expertise and creativity to engage followers, inspire meal ideas, and shape food trends. They may work independently or partner with others to grow their audience and impact within the food industry.

How much money do food influencers make?

Food influencers' earnings vary widely based on their follower count, engagement, and brand partnerships. Top influencers can earn thousands to hundreds of thousands of dollars per sponsored post, while smaller accounts may earn less or supplement income through affiliate marketing and content monetization. Income depends on factors like niche, platform, and audience size.

How do Food Influencers typically collaborate with brands and restaurants, and what should applicants expect during these partnerships?

Food Influencers often work closely with brands and restaurants through sponsored posts, product reviews, and event promotions. These collaborations usually involve negotiating deliverables, such as creating content that aligns with the brand's image while maintaining authenticity. Applicants should be prepared for clear communication, timely content delivery, and occasionally adhering to specific guidelines or disclosure requirements. Building strong professional relationships and maintaining creative integrity are key to successful partnerships in this role.

HelloFresh is a meal-kit company based in Berlin, Germany. It is the largest meal-kit provider in the United States and also has operations in Australia, Canada, New Zealand, and the United Kingdom, as well as Europe (Germany, Austria, Switzerland, Belgium, Netherlands, Luxembourg, France, Italy, Ireland, Spain and Scandinavia). HelloFresh’s mission is to change the way people eat forever by helping consumers save money with every meal, democratizing access to high-quality food, allowing everyone to enjoy a varied and tasty diet, and reducing food waste through CO2 neutral delivery of every box.
